4 Spring Cleaning Tips for Healthy Air

2 minute read

Click play to listen to the Four Spring Cleaning Tips for Healthy Air article. 

What tasks are on your spring cleaning list this year?

From light refreshes to deep, thorough cleans, it’s time to breathe new life into your home! While you and your family clean from room to room, make sure you’re breathing Healthy Air by following some simple tips.

1. Change Air Filters

Heating and cooling systems contain air filters that need to be changed regularly. Keeping them maintained helps the systems operate efficiently, and protects the air being dispersed throughout your home.

Most filters come with a recommendation for how often they should be changed. If you’re unsure, you can look at the color of the filter—it starts white and becomes darker shades of gray over time. If you see particles caked on the filter, it’s definitely time to change it out.

2. Trap Dust

Dust is inevitable around the home, and we don’t usually notice it until it gets blown into the air and we end up sneezing. Thankfully, there are a few ways you can manage dust throughout the cleaning process.

A damp cloth is highly effective at capturing dust from surfaces big and small, including the nooks and crannies of window shades and shelving units. When dusting objects up high, like a ceiling fan, cover furniture and other items with a drop cloth that can be washed or shaken out after dusting.

Vacuuming is a great way to finish the job and capture any dust that got displaced during the cleaning process. Vacuum floors and furniture, and don’t forget about the dust that’s accumulated under tables, chairs, and couches.

3. Avoid Scents and Unnecessary Chemicals

Many household cleaners, air fresheners, and even scented candles can fill your home with harmful volatile organic compounds (VOCs). These VOCs can irritate asthma symptoms and other respiratory conditions.

The American Lung Association recommends avoiding air fresheners and any products that contain fragrances, VOCs, and flammable ingredients. Instead, clean with products like vinegar and add fresh scents with things like dried potpourri.
